Agent Shift Mac OS

Posted on  by
Welcome to vRealize Configuration Manager : Managing Mac OS X Machines : Manually Install the Agent on Mac OS X Machines

Agent Shift Mac Os 11

For some time now I am running into situations were the McAfee Agent installed on Apple systems is not responding to the 'run client task now' command (failed) or 'wake up' ePO function. This is happening with different Agent and os versions, quite recently with Agent 5.5.1.374 and OS 10.14.3. Any solutions or troubleshooting steps that come to. Note: To see a complete list of keyboard shortcuts, open Google Slides and press Ctrl + / (Windows, Chrome OS) or ⌘ + / (Mac). Use ⌘ for Mac or Ctrl f or Windows, Chrome OS. So use without switch “-f” for normal Installation and vice versa.Normal Install / upgrade- $ sudo sh install.sh -i -For force re-install- $ sudo sh install.sh -i -f. In conclusion, by doing simple tweak we did force re-install same version of McAfee agent on Mac OS. Hope this does helps you.

Install the appropriate version of the VCM Agent on each of your licensed target machines to enable communication between the Collector and the managed Mac OS X machines.

Installing the Agent on Mac OS X machines is a manual operation. The Agent is packaged as a Universal Binary Installer. You can run the installation process in silent mode or interactive mode. To run the installation in silent mode, you must edit the configuration options in the csi.config file. The file is edited to accommodate different target machine types.

Prerequisites

  • Verify that the machine on which you intend to install the Agent has enough free disk space. Formore information, see the VCM Installation Guide.
  • If you are installing the Agent on Red Hat Enterprise Linux (RHEL) 7, Oracle Enterprise Linux (OEL) 7, or CentOS 7, verify that the net-tools and redhat-lsb-core packages are installed on the target machine.
  • Identify the Agent binary installation package that you will copy from the Collector to the managed machine. See the VCM Installation Guide.
  • If you run an installation in silent mode, modify the appropriate csi.config file variable options. See Installation Options for Max OS X csi.config .
  • If you select (x)inetd/launchd for CSI_AGENT_RUN_OPTION, verify that (x)inetd/launchd is running on the target machines. On some versions, when (x)inetd/launchd services are not configured, (x)inetd/launchd will not stay running. To ensure the Agent installation completes successfully, pass a - stayalive option to (x)inetd/launchd. See Installation Options for Max OS X csi.config .
  • Log in to the target Mac OS X machine as root, or have sudo as root.
  • Select the method that you want to use to copy files to the target machines. You can use ftp, sftp, or cp using an NFS share. If you use ftp to copy the package to your machine, you must use binary mode.
  • If you are collecting non-ASCII information from the target machines, install a UTF-8 locale. To determine the locales installed on your operating system, use the locale -a command.

Procedure

  1. Copy the appropriate Agent binary installation package from the Collector to the machine on which you will install the Agent.

    The Agent packagesare located on the Collector in Program Files (x86)VMwareVCMInstallerPackages.

  2. On the target machine, run chmod u+x <filename> to set the execute permission for the file owner on the Agent binary file.
  3. In the directory to which you copied the file, run ./CMAgent.<version>.<Agent binary name> to create the necessary directory structure and extract the files.

    To force an overwrite of any existing files, include the -o option.For example: /CMAgent.<version>.Darwin -o.

    The command and output is similar to the following example, but with different file names depending on the operating system.

    # ./CMAgent.<version>.Darwin
    UnZipSFX 5.51 of 22 May 2004, by Info-ZIP (http://www.info-zip.org).
    creating: CSIInstall/
    inflating: CSIInstall/CMAgent.5.1.0.Darwin.i386
    inflating: CSIInstall/CMAgent.5.1.0.Darwin.ppc
    inflating: CSIInstall/csi.config
    inflating: CSIInstall/InstallCMAgent

  4. Run cd <extractedpath>/CSIInstall to change the directory to the location where the InstallCMAgent executable file was extracted.
  5. Run ls -la to validate that the correct files are in the <extractedpath>/CSIInstall directory.

    FileDescription
    InstallCMAgentInstallation script.
    csi.configConfiguration file for the installation. This is the file you can modify to include installation options for silent rather than interactive installation processes.
    packagesInstallation packages.
    scriptsScripts required for the installation.
  6. (Optional) Edit the csi.config file to customize the installation variables and save your changes.

    1. Run the chmod u+x csi.config command to add write file permissions if the file has only read permissions set.
    2. Modify the csi.config file options based on your local requirements and save the file.
    3. Copy the modified and saved csi.config file to the extracted location.

      For example, # cp /<safelocation>/csi.config /<extractedlocation>/CSIInstall/csi.config.

  7. Run InstallCMAgent in either silent mode or interactive mode.

    OptionAction

    Silent mode

    Run the # ./CSIInstall/InstallCMAgent -s command.

    Install the Agent using the silent mode if you manually edited the csi.config file, if you modifiedthe csi.config file using the interactive method, or if you are using a custom configuration file thatyou saved from a previous Agent installation. This mode uses the valuesspecified in csi.config without prompting for input.

    When the silent installation finishes, a summary of the installation process and status appears.Verify that the installation finished without errors.

    Interactive mode

    Run the # ./CSIInstall/InstallCMAgent command.

    Install the Agent using the interactive mode if you did not modify the csi.config and to respond to each prompt toaccept or change each parameter in the csi.config file as it runs. As a result of your responses, the csi.config is modified.

    The preinstallation stage of interactive mode checks for a valid user, CSI_USER. If the user exists, you are not prompted for these configuration values.

    • CSI_USER_NO_LOGIN_SHELL
    • CSI_USER_PRIMARY_GROUP
    • CSI_USER_PRIMARY_GID
    • CSI_USER_USE_NEXT_AVAILABLE_LOCAL_GID

    You are prompted for these values only when the CSI_USER user account is not found.

    The User and the Group are created in the local directory service storage.

    You can check the installation status in the installation log file. The file is located in <CSI_PARENT_DIRECTORY>/log/install.log.

  8. Run ls –la /CSI_PARENT_DIRECTORY/CMAgent to verify that all the required files and directories were installed.

    /CSI_PARENT_DIRECTORY/CMAgent is the default directory. If you changed the directory name during installation, modify the ls -la command to display the custom directory name.

    drwxr-x--- 3 root cfgsoft 4096 Jul 2 17:34 Agent
    drwxr-x--- 3 root cfgsoft 4096 Jul 2 17:34 CFC
    -rw-rw---- 1 root cfgsoft 49993 Jul 2 17:34 CSIRegistry
    -rw-rw---- 1 root cfgsoft 0 Jul 2 17:34 .CSIRegistry.lck
    drwxrwx--- 3 csi_acct cfgsoft 4096 Jul 2 17:34 data
    drwxrwx--- 3 root cfgsoft 4096 Jul 2 17:34 ECMu
    drwxr-x--- 6 root cfgsoft 4096 Jul 2 17:34 install
    lrwxrwxrwx 1 root root 20 Jul 2 17:34 log -> /var/log/CMAgent/log
    dr-xr-x--x 3 root cfgsoft 4096 Jul 2 17:34 ThirdParty
    drwxr-xr-x 2 root root 4096 Jul 2 17:34 uninstall

  9. Run # netstat -na grep <port_number> to verify that the Agent is installed correctly, listening on the assigned port, and ready to collect data.

    The default <port_number> is 26542 for VCM installations.

What to do next

Run a collection for Mac OS X data. See Collect Mac OS X Data.

See Also

Manually Uninstalling the Mac OS X Agent

Help us improve this topic. Send feedback to . Technical Support © 2006–2015 VMware, Inc. All rights reserved. This product is protected by U.S. and international copyright and intellectual property laws. VMware products are covered by one or more patents listed at http://www.vmware.com/go/patents. VMware is a registered trademark or trademark of VMware, Inc. in the United States and/or other jurisdictions. All other marks and names mentioned herein may be trademarks of their respective companies.

Organizations today increasingly deploy Mac devices. Due to this overall influx, the amount of Active Directory (AD) password reset requests for Mac devices has grown exponentially, as well. Thus, the IT teams of these organizations are forced to spend a lot of time handling repetitive tickets. To solve this issue, organizations can now adopt a self-service password management solution, such as ADSelfService Plus. This tool solution provides Mac users a self-service web portal manage their own passwords and accounts, without depending on the IT team, reducing administrative time spent on repetitive requests.

Streamlining the Solution

In the past, the web portal from ADSelfService Plus had to be accessed from a dedicated, secure system. This is no longer the case; ADSelfService Plus has introduced the Mac login agent for password resets. The login agent is an extension of the web client, which allows Mac users to reset their Active Directory passwords right from their login screen. The login agent is not a complete substitute the web portal, but allows users to reset passwords from the comfort of their own systems.

What Can the Login Agent Do?

The login agent is run by the Mac OS as a part of the lock screen.Clicking the “Reset Password/Unlock Account” button opens a secure browser, from which AD users can authenticate themselves, and reset their forgotten passwords.

Easily access the login agent from the desktop by keying in the keyboard shortcuts “CONTROL+SHIFT+EJECT” or “CONTROL+SHIFT+POWER”, depending on the Mac version.

How Do I Enable the Login Agent?

Installing the Mac login agent is simple and quick. You can bulk install client software to the users' machines from a centralized ADSelfService Plus console, through domain or OU-based filters, or a CSV file with the necessary details of the Mac devices. ADSelfService Plus also allows administrators to customize the icon and text associated with the login agent. For more customization details, click here.

The ADSelfService Plus Mac Login Agent Advantage

The login agent for Mac users, from ADSelfService Plus, is advantageous to both users and administrators alike.

  • Allows Mac users to reset their password and unlock their account directly from their device, without having to search for a secure terminal to access the ADSelfService Plus portal.
  • Reduces the workload of administrators and help desk personnel.
  • Decreases turnaround time, to increase user productivity.
  • Minimizes cost incurred on Active Directory password reset requests.

Enable macOS users to reset AD passwords from their login screen.

Thanks!

Your download is in progress and it will be completed in just a few seconds!
If you face any issues, download manually here

Password self-service

Free Active Directory users from attending lengthy help desk calls by allowing them to self-service their password resets/ account unlock tasks. Hassle-free password change for Active Directory users with ADSelfService Plus ‘Change Password’ console.

One identity with Single sign-on

Get seamless one-click access to 100+ cloud applications. With enterprise single sign-on, users can access all their cloud applications with their Active Directory credentials. Thanks to ADSelfService Plus!

Password/Account Expiry Notification

Intimate Active Directory users of their impending password/account expiry by mailing them these password/account expiry notifications.

Password Synchronizer

Synchronize Windows Active Directory user password/account changes across multiple systems, automatically, including Office 365, G Suite, IBM iSeries and more.

Password Policy Enforcer

Ensure strong user passwords that resist various hacking threats with ADSelfService Plus by enforcing Active Directory users to adhere to compliant passwords via displaying password complexity requirements.

Directory Self-Update & Corporate Search

Agent shift mac os catalina

Agent Shift Mac Os X

Portal that lets Active Directory users update their latest information and a quick search facility to scout for information about peers by using search keys, like contact number, of the personality being searched.